Applicants must have

  • High School Diploma or equivalent (minimum requirement)
  • 45 hours of Child Growth & Development
  • 45 hours of Preschool Curriculum (required for ages 2–5)
  • 45 hours of Infant-Toddler Certificate (required for ages 6 weeks–24 months)
  • At least 1 year of experience in a licensed childcare facility or 30 college credits
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Knowledge of children's social, emotional, intellectual, and physical development
  • Commitment to ongoing professional development
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and actively engage with children throughout the day

Preferred Qualifications

•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education or a related field

Infant Toddler Teachers Are in Steady Demand

In Maryland, infant and toddler teachers are commonly needed in licensed child care settings, especially where programs must meet age-specific staffing and credential requirements. This role can be competitive because employers often look for a high school diploma, documented child growth and development training, and either infant experience in a licensed facility or college credits tied to early childhood.
